Overview
ISO 2206:1987 - Packaging - Complete, filled transport packages - Identification of parts when testing defines a consistent system for identifying surfaces, edges and corners of filled transport packages to be used during packaging tests. The standard covers parallelepipedal (box-like) and cylindrical packages, sacks and bags, and gives a method for numbering parts of miscellaneous package shapes. It ensures reproducible orientation and unambiguous referencing of package faces in test reports.
Key Topics
- Scope: Applies to complete, filled transport packages used in testing and evaluation.
- Identification system:
- Parallelepipedal packages: when a face is presented to the observer, the top = 1, right = 2, bottom = 3, left = 4, nearest = 5, farthest = 6.
- Edges: identified by the two surface numbers forming the edge (e.g., 1-2).
- Corners: identified by the three surface numbers meeting at the corner (e.g., 1-2-5).
- Cylindrical packages: endpoints of two perpendicular diameters on the top face are numbered 1-3-5-7, with the parallel lines along the cylinder axis numbered 2-4-6-8; typical edge/line identifiers include 1-2, 3-4, 5-6, 7-8.
- Sacks and bags: orientation rules specify welded end and lateral seam placement; numbering follows the same face-identifier logic (top 1, right 2, bottom 3, left 4, welded end 5, filling end 6).
- Placement rules: The package should be positioned as it would be during transport. If orientation is unknown, the manufacturing joint (if present) is placed vertically to the observer’s right.
- Application to miscellaneous shapes: The standard permits adapting the numbering method from the described cases to suit irregular packages.
Applications
- Provides a standardized reference for test labs performing drop tests, compression, vibration and handling evaluations so results are clear and reproducible.
- Used by packaging engineers and quality assurance teams to document failure locations and to compare test outcomes.
- Helpful for manufacturers, shippers and regulators who need consistent reporting of test procedures and damage analysis.
